Looking for the best family rafting experience in Arenal, Costa Rica? The Balsa River offers the perfect balance of excitement and safety, with Class II–III rapids ideal for families and first-time rafters. This half-day adventure delivers plenty of action while remaining accessible for children ages 8 to 12, making it one of the top family-friendly rafting experiences near Arenal Volcano. Experience Overview Your river guide will pick you up directly from your hotel and accompany you on a scenic 30-minute drive to the river put-in. Upon arrival, you will receive a comprehensive safety briefing, including equipment usage and paddling commands. Once everyone is ready, the adventure begins. Navigate exciting rapids such as Magnetic Rock and Dredges during a 2-hour journey down the beautiful Balsa River. Between rapids, take in the lush surroundings and keep an eye out for wildlife like monkeys, sloths, and toucans. Enjoy a refreshing swim stop, along with tropical fruits and cold drinks along the way. A Highlight Beyond the River At the end of the tour, the experience continues with a traditional Costa Rican lunch served at a countryside farm designed to immerse guests in local culture. Technical Information ● River Time: 1.5 to 2 hours ● Distance: 10 km ● River Difficulty: Class II–III ● Minimum Age: 8 years
